Commit Graph

187 Commits (43da0a80d4f73b1ce828091cbc4fc8ece6f2036b)

Author SHA1 Message Date
Cai Yudong 891c202b73
Use GlobalParamTable for all components ()
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-12-23 18:39:11 +08:00
edward.zeng f2d25ce338
[skip e2e] Refine rootcoord comment ()
Signed-off-by: Edward Zeng <jie.zeng@zilliz.com>
2021-12-23 14:34:13 +08:00
jaime 9e9475b4fe
[skip e2e] Fix grammar mistake in meta_table ()
Signed-off-by: yun.zhang <yun.zhang@zilliz.com>

Co-authored-by: yun.zhang <yun.zhang@zilliz.com>
2021-12-22 21:31:15 +08:00
Jiquan Long 8a63dba149
Add consistency level field in collection meta ()
Signed-off-by: dragondriver <jiquan.long@zilliz.com>
2021-12-21 19:49:02 +08:00
XuanYang-cn 3c2605f174
[skip e2e]Update license for rc util ()
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2021-12-21 19:19:21 +08:00
XuanYang-cn 83df76d7af
[skip e2e]Update license for rc timetick ()
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2021-12-21 18:50:59 +08:00
XuanYang-cn 9fa2d757a2
[skip e2e]Update license for rc timestamp ()
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2021-12-20 19:01:12 +08:00
XuanYang-cn 907f554a0b
[skip e2e]Update license for rc suffix ()
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2021-12-20 18:49:06 +08:00
XuanYang-cn 33f326d576
[skip e2e]Update license for rc root_coord ()
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2021-12-20 17:45:37 +08:00
XuanYang-cn 8f8021eeb8
[skip e2e]Update license for rc proxyclient manager ()
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2021-12-17 14:23:29 +08:00
XuanYang-cn 67d99490ed
[skip e2e]Update license for rc paramtable ()
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2021-12-17 14:21:31 +08:00
XuanYang-cn fc67e4bc93
[skip e2e]Update license for rc proxymanager ()
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2021-12-17 14:19:36 +08:00
Cai Yudong dea0e0277c
[skip e2e] Update root_coord imports ()
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-12-17 14:13:16 +08:00
Cai Yudong 807aab3dd8
[skip e2e] Update metrics_info imports ()
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-12-17 14:11:26 +08:00
XuanYang-cn 12173f94f0
[skip ci]Update license for rc meta table ()
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2021-12-16 10:07:10 +08:00
XuanYang-cn c544bb21ac
[skip ci]Update license for rc dml channels ()
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2021-12-16 10:03:23 +08:00
XuanYang-cn 12766540bd
[skip ci]Update license for rc meta snapshot ()
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2021-12-16 10:01:35 +08:00
xige-16 42ac5f76ed
Add constraints to the combination of load and release ()
Signed-off-by: xige-16 <xi.ge@zilliz.com>
2021-12-15 22:11:09 +08:00
jaime 769b05682a
[skip ci] Fix grammar mistake in suffix_snapshot ()
Signed-off-by: yun.zhang <yun.zhang@zilliz.com>

Co-authored-by: yun.zhang <yun.zhang@zilliz.com>
2021-12-15 12:07:44 +08:00
cai.zhang 9f23fc7f2a
Register the service when the component state is healthy ()
Signed-off-by: Cai.Zhang <cai.zhang@zilliz.com>
2021-12-15 11:47:10 +08:00
Cai Yudong 829077ad0c
Optimize reSentDdMsg logic ()
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-12-15 08:59:08 +08:00
Cai Yudong 30e18cb5a7
Optimize rootcoord reSendDdMsg ()
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-12-14 19:15:06 +08:00
Xiangyu Wang 405b3cd932
Use the same lint rules with golint in revive ()
Signed-off-by: Xiangyu Wang <xiangyu.wang@zilliz.com>
2021-12-14 15:31:07 +08:00
Cai Yudong 2b59e15ef4
Use typeutil.RootCoordRole instead of Params.RoleName in rootcoord ()
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-12-13 09:59:27 +08:00
JackLCL 2905182282
[skip ci]Fix error log output format in task.go ()
Signed-off-by: JackLCL <chenglong.li@zilliz.com>
2021-12-10 10:19:10 +08:00
JackLCL 3ddcec79b4
[skip ci]Fix error log output format in root_coord_test.go ()
Signed-off-by: JackLCL <chenglong.li@zilliz.com>
2021-12-10 10:17:30 +08:00
cai.zhang 342200ce13
Estimate the memory size of the index before building the index ()
Signed-off-by: Cai.Zhang <cai.zhang@zilliz.com>
2021-12-09 14:19:40 +08:00
XuanYang-cn a9a332dbcf
Fix empty segment compact and load ()
1. Fix compaction save empty segment bug
2. Fix load empty segment bug
3. Add UT for dmlchannels to 100%

Resolves: 

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2021-12-09 11:03:08 +08:00
congqixia c289a19fb8
Remove log string concat in root_coord.go ()
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2021-12-08 14:23:05 +08:00
congqixia e4de86ba42
Update rootcoord state to unhealthy before stopping ()
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2021-12-07 18:39:03 +08:00
Bingyi Sun 92eff1565c
Fix unlocked mutex in rootcoord ()
issue: 
Signed-off-by: sunby <bingyi.sun@zilliz.com>

Co-authored-by: sunby <bingyi.sun@zilliz.com>
2021-12-06 17:25:35 +08:00
Cai Yudong 1a806a174a
Support load collection with multiple vector column ()
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-12-03 11:29:33 +08:00
congqixia 9af7e179f2
Fix zero length slice declaration in timeticksync.go ()
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2021-11-29 20:21:41 +08:00
Bingyi Sun a05a74fca2
Improve proxy manager in rootcoord ()
issue: 
Signed-off-by: sunby <bingyi.sun@zilliz.com>

Co-authored-by: sunby <bingyi.sun@zilliz.com>
2021-11-29 17:33:41 +08:00
Cai Yudong cbbeb2a383
Add debug log when proxy idle for a long time ()
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-11-27 13:57:16 +08:00
Cai Yudong 6188ac280b
Fix drop alias error ()
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-11-25 18:03:17 +08:00
Cai Yudong 858e95f377
Move dmlChannel and deltaChannel into timeticksync ()
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-11-25 10:07:15 +08:00
dragondriver 6c4c0ef6b5
Add more deploy metrics ()
Signed-off-by: dragondriver <jiquan.long@zilliz.com>
2021-11-24 15:43:15 +08:00
Cai Yudong 1f27eb604e
Remove all index when drop collection ()
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-11-23 23:01:15 +08:00
congqixia 4121e31df1
Send SIGINT to runner goroutine after etcd disconnects ()
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2021-11-22 16:23:17 +08:00
Cai Yudong 99b3c56b3e
Update rootcoord debug log ()
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-11-22 16:01:14 +08:00
Cai Yudong d4c297b1a8
Enhance dml channel operations ()
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-11-21 21:33:13 +08:00
dragondriver ee0f753f7a
Fix datarace between GetComponentStates and Register ()
Signed-off-by: dragondriver <jiquan.long@zilliz.com>
2021-11-19 13:57:12 +08:00
Cai Yudong 074687e32e
Unify rootcoord debug log ()
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-11-19 12:11:12 +08:00
congqixia 27715c15f4
Fix 0 len slice declaration for dml_channels.go ()
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2021-11-18 22:33:26 +08:00
congqixia 5edbb82610
Add session revoke ()
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2021-11-16 22:31:14 +08:00
Cai Yudong b0f268e087
Add more debug log for proxy registry in rootcoord ()
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-11-16 19:21:49 +08:00
Xiangyu Wang 12f50cb22c
[skip ci]Update OWNERS files ()
Signed-off-by: Xiangyu Wang <xiangyu.wang@zilliz.com>
2021-11-16 15:41:11 +08:00
Cai Yudong 29e9adc7be
Fix golint warnings for rootcoord ()
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-11-16 14:27:11 +08:00
Cai Yudong 173e7b3808
Fix golint warnings for rootcoord/root_coord.go ()
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-11-16 14:25:17 +08:00